There were a total of 3,047 shooters from all over the USA and also from Canada, Australia, Brazil, England, New Zealand and South Africa at the 2023 ATA Grand American World Trapshooting Championships held August 2nd to 12th, 2023 at the World Shooting & Recreational Complex in Sparta, IL.

Texas was well represented by 79 shooters attending the AIM Grand and the Grand American. Between them they brought home a total of 52 trophies and a great time was had by all! A big "Congratulations!" on all their acheivements.
